摘要:
在温度监测系统的设计工作中,传统的温度显示和设备控制中心都是在PC机上。但是由于PC机是固定终端,有一定的局限性,更好的方案则是把显示和监测中心转移到移动终端上。因此,为了更有效地监测目标,基于移动终端的温度监测系统应运而生。本系统在介绍了一种基于单片机和温度传感芯DS18B20来进行温度测量的方法的基础上,提出了采用无线通信模块MC8630与智能手机进行数据传输,并利用手机进行环境监测的方案。实验表明,该方案是可行的,软件最终在手机端上运行良好
Abstract:
In the field of temperature monitoring and measurement system design,the traditional temperature display and control center equipment are PC.However, as PC is a fixed terminal,there are some limitations,the better program is to transfer display and monitoring center to the mobile terminal.Therefore,in order to more effectively monitor the target,temperature monitoring and measurement system based on mobile terminal came into being.This system proposes a method for temperature measurement based on MCU and DS18B20,and presents the use of the wireless communication module MC8630 on data transmission with smart phones and use cell phones to conduct environmental monitoring program.As a result of experiment,the scheme is feasible,the ultimate software in mobile phone runs well
